Anna University B.Tech EEE (R13) 7th Sem High Voltage Engineering Syllabus

High Voltage Engineering for B.Tech 7th sem is covered here. This gives the details about credits, number of hours and other details along with reference books for the course.

The detailed syllabus for High Voltage Engineering B.Tech (R13) seventhsem is as follows

OBJECTIVES:

  • To understand the various types of over voltages in power system and protection methods.
  • Generation of over voltages in laboratories.
  • Measurement of over voltages.
  • Nature of Breakdown mechanism in solid, liquid and gaseous dielectrics.
  • Testing of power apparatus and insulation coordination.

UNIT I : OVER VOLTAGES IN ELECTRICAL POWER SYSTEMS   [9 hours]
Causes of over voltages and its effects on power system – Lightning, switching surges and temporary overvoltages, Corona and its effects – Reflection and Refraction of Travelling waves- Protection against overvoltages.

UNIT II : DIELECTRIC BREAKDOWN      [9 hours]
Gaseous breakdown in uniform and non-uniform fields – Corona discharges – Vacuum breakdown – Conduction and breakdown in pure and commercial liquids, Maintenance of oil Quality – Breakdown mechanisms in solid and composite dielectrics.

UNIT III : GENERATION OF HIGH VOLTAGES AND HIGH CURRENTS     [9 hours]
Generation of High DC, AC, impulse voltages and currents – Triggering and control of impulse generators.

[TOTAL : 45 PERIODS]

OUTCOMES:

  • Ability to understand and analyze power system operation, stability, control and protection.

TEXT BOOKS:

  • S.Naidu and V. Kamaraju, ‘High Voltage Engineering’, Tata McGraw Hill, Fifth Edition, 2013.
  • E. Kuffel and W.S. Zaengl, J.Kuffel, ‘High voltage Engineering fundamentals’, Newnes Second Edition Elsevier , New Delhi, 2005.
  • Subir Ray,’ An Introduction to High Voltage Engineering’ PHI Learning Private Limited, New Delhi, Second Edition, 2013.

REFERENCES:

  • L.L. Alston, ‘High Voltage Technology’, Oxford University Press, First Indian Edition, 2011.
  • C.L. Wadhwa, ‘High voltage Engineering’, New Age International Publishers, Third Edition, 2010
